ActivePartner: NB Power

Point Lepreau, New Brunswick

A License to Prepare Site application for commercial demonstration of the ARC reactor in New Brunswick, Canada was submitted to the Canadian Nuclear Safety Commission in 2023.

  • Located adjacent to existing nuclear infrastructure
  • Grid connection available
  • Provincial government support
  • CNSC regulatory familiarity
ActivePartner: Nucleon Energy (NuARC Joint Venture)

Alberta Industrial Energy Project

ARC and Nucleon Energy have formed NuARC, a partnership entity to deploy non-emitting power starting in Alberta, Canada. The project targets Alberta’s industrial energy demands: oil sands process heat, petrochemical facilities, and grid stability for the province’s growing data center corridor.

  • NuARC joint venture with Nucleon Energy
  • Industrial heat application
  • Provincial energy diversification strategy
  • Heavy industry decarbonization
Active

United States, First Commercial Deployment

Advancing ARC's first US deployment. Actively engaged with hyperscale data center developers for dedicated behind-the-meter power solutions. NRC pre-application engagement underway.

  • Behind-the-meter model for data centers
  • Multiple site options under evaluation
  • NRC regulatory pathway in progress
